Switchgear for Renewable Energy: Choosing the Right Equipment

To achieve optimal performance, and efficiency which reduces environmental impact, renewable companies are investing in advanced technologies and solutions. One of the ways in achieving this is by increasing the operating voltage. When choosing switchgear for the purposes of renewable energy, there are different factors to be considered.

Level of Voltage: The voltage level of the renewable energy should be matching the switch gear you get. The equipment which requires high voltage is sophisticated and costly.

Type of Switchgear: There are different types of switchgear for high voltage systems and Low voltage systems. High-Voltage switch gears are-Air insulated switch gears, Gas insulated and highly integrated. Low-voltage switch gears are contactors, circuit-breakers, Molded cases, and miniature circuit breakers, Fuses. 

Environmental Conditions: It is better to check the environmental condition of the place the switch gears being installed which includes humidity, temperature etc.

Safety: Safety features such as interlocks,grounding, and protective relays could be checked while selecting one to avoid accidents and other risks.

The Future of Switchgear: Trends and Innovations to Watch

As the global demand for electricity is increasing and new energy sources are integrated into the electrical system, there are many innovations to watch out for.

Digital Switchgear: Digitization is a worldly phenomenon, the trend in digital switchgear would be widely used as it can provide dynamic monitoring with the use of sensors and communication systems. This helps the operators to respond quickly.

Hybrid Switchgear: This is the combination of traditional air-insulated switchgear and SF6 gas-insulated technologies. This compact design hybrid switchgear allows for more efficient use of space in the substation, particularly in urban areas where space is limited.

Vacuum Switchgear: Vacuum switchgear uses vacuum interrupters to provide switching and protection. This switchgear is maintenance free which is the main advantage.

Modular Design: Modular switchgear solutions can also help to reduce cost by minimizing the requirement for customized equipment.

Switchgear for Industrial Applications: Key Considerations for Selection and InstallationSwitchgear is typically used in industries for advanced electrical hubs which operate under voltage tolerance in harsh environmental conditions.

In order to select the best switchgear for any application, it is necessary to consider both control and protection aspects. It detects faults but also serves as a control mechanism for the electrical system. It is also to be noted to seek the assistance of expertise as it is to be installed according to the manufacturer’s instruction for avoiding further complications. other factors are:

  • Consideration of cost
  • Voltage
  • Protection requirements
  • Type of Switchgear
